Tribune News Service
Jalandhar, February 8
A two-week Faculty Development Programme (FDP) on entrepreneurship started at Guru Nanak Dev University College, Ladowali, here on Monday. The programme was organised under the aegis of science and technology department of the college.
Dr Benipal, dean, college development council, marked his virtual presence as the chief guest. Moreover, Sudhir Gera, partner of Kirloskar oil and engine and also an expert on entrepreneurship, was present as the special guest.
While commencing the session, Dr Benipal remarked that before starting a business, one must study its effects on society and the environment. On the occasion, he commended the great efforts of Dr Ashish Arora, chief coordinator of FDP, and also recommended such knowledgeable programmes in the near future.
Dr Kamlesh Singh Duggal, OSD and program patron of the college, thanked Benipal and Gera.
